Output 335963b5d54b2ecc51d852055c95f3fe7354c215b3b2949edca9851dd6cc97be:1

value
62404361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1bdc3ac49517fa826ba3490435ecabfe4a036c OP_EQUAL
address
3HZcsgrDvE54Km9PdoE7wNUHfeb65fSHzw
transaction
335963b5d54b2ecc51d852055c95f3fe7354c215b3b2949edca9851dd6cc97be
spent
true